Body of 79-Year-Old Missing Man Found in Elizabeth

Elizabeth New Jersey

The body of 79-year-old Edward Purcell, who was reported missing in January, was found this weekend in an Elizabeth backyard.

The circumstances surrounding the death of Purcell, who last lived on Cherry Street in Elizabeth, is unknown at this time but an autopsy determined that there was no foul play involved, said Lt. Daniel Geddes.

Police responded to the ​800 block of Gebhardt Avenue to investigate a report of a suspicious person Saturday at approximately 12:55 a.m., according to police.

While there, uniformed personnel searching the backyard came across a deceased elderly man's body lying on the ground.  
 
The body was hidden from sight, by garage behind the residence. 
 
Officers immediately observed that the male was in advanced stages of decomposition and had clearly been there for some time.  
 
The deceased, was later identified as 79-year-old Elizabeth resident Edward Purcell.  
 
Purcell was reported missing by family members on January 28th of this year.  
 
An autopsy was performed by the Union County Medical Examiner’s Office, where it was determined that there was no evidence of foul play surrounding the circumstances of Mr. Purcell’s death.
